Erro comum:
Learners sometimes confuse 'bin' with 'basket'; 'bin' usually refers to a container with solid sides and often a lid, while 'basket' is often woven and open.

Definição

A container that you use to keep things, especially trash or recycling.

A container used for holding waste, materials, or other items, usually with a lid.
